Landscape Lamps
This trio of lacquered, turned wood lamps is handmade in Yorkshire but inspired by the shapes and palette of rural Scotland. The designs – Munro, Cairn and Thistle – come in a choice of three colours. £295 each, lampshade not included. formbytallboy.
